    After two dissappointing seasons of indoor growing, decided to try something new this year.

    The Loveshack is a small shed on my property, which we converted, and ran two seperate rooms inside, one a veg and one a flowering. The problem seemed to be too much heat and not enough power to kewl properly, then came the bugs (little rat bastard spider mites). The only solution for me was to start over. Got rid of all my plants, completely cleaned the rooms out and sanitized with bleach and let set dormant for a month. Then re-bleached, and let set dormant another month. Now the room was clean!

    To deal with my heat issues, replced the 2-400w hps lights with some sweet 4ft energy effecient T-8's. Also decided to only use the Loveshack as a starter room. One room has clones and babies, the other, more mature plants.

    I started my first batch back in November 08, when I got some nice Sour Diesel clones from a friend in NorCal. These have done really well in the nursery, and when they got about 12" moved them into the larger room.

    Then came into some clones from another friend, some Sour Diesel x OG Kush, and 4 weeks later some Ogre Kush and HinduKush x Skunk #1. So this will be my 2009 grow.

    Out where I live you can almost grow year round.....almost!
    My plan for this season was to keep the babies warm and safe until early spring, then move them outside. Well that time has come!

    This last weekend took the 3 Sour D's and put them outside, moved the Sour Diesel x OG Kush into the big room and have been moving all the others up in container size and getting these stable. Have aslo been able to take clones from each strain and making more!

    I took some pix of the Sour D's outside. They stand about 24" tall and it is only the beginning of March.....these, I hope will start budding in the next few days and should be done by mid May?

    The next batch to go outside will be in about 4 more weeks....and another batch 4 weeks ather that, and so on. Then I will shut the Loveshack down for the summer, when it is just too hot inside, and start over again in Oct or Nov. We will see how it goes.

  9. Things look great Loveshack. I was thinking about the worm issue. They must be either be dropping off the fruit trees into your bud or crawling up from the bottom. Are there any fruit tree branches hanging out over the plants? You may be able to make a barrier of aluminum tape and wrap it around them stems when they get thicker. Just dont attach the sticky part of the tape directly to the stem, use paper against the plant and wrap the tape around the paper. Just some thoughts...
     
  10. Old Pork, when I was looking through your grow, noticed you using the aluminum tape, and was intrigued, but I am not sure if it will work with these little rat bastards.
    I am not sure, but I think that the worms are from eggs layed on the leaves from moths.
    I will try almost anything to get rid of these little buggers. They don't show up until late July, so I will be looking for the tape down here. Thanks for the input.
